WebDSC is a useful tool for studying this phenomenon known as “physical aging”. The initial DSC heating scan of physically aged polymers commonly reveals an endothermic peak near the trailing edge of the Tg step-change. This peak is referred to as the “enthalpy of relaxation” or “enthalpic recovery” (ΔH R ). Webheating curve of water. Conic Sections: Parabola and Focus. example
